| 114924 | 2003-01-18 13:56:00 | are you sure that your card supports video in. And it is not just a TV out plug in the back of your card. Just a while ago on gameplanet this guy was trying to say that you could use your tv out as a tv in(lol) this was a bigg unknown secret.(lolx2) and all you had to do was down load drivers for my vivo from nvidia and cap tv and you were away. Of course this didn't work. But you could try captv. It is free. I know you dont want to play on a tv. but it may have some thing useful in it.some one else here will know. But what sort of card do you have and what brand.Why I mention this gameplanet post is that is the same error that was thrown up when this fellow tried to use a tv out plug as tv,video in. Error 10 missing device. I would say that means no TVin decoder chip.Correct me if I am wrong please. | valiantnz (1709) | ||
